I've succesfully installed XAMPP 1.7.2a on Snow Leopard. However, after a few days I'm getting this error when trying to open XAMPP.app:
Code: Select all
XAMPP is installed in a wrong Location!

I've got no idea why it's giving this error. I'm still able to start XAMPP via the Terminal, however. Any ideas?

My guess is that you used an older XAMPP controls application (the one that came with the XAMPP for Mac 0.7-series). The icon of this application is round with a dimmed X in it. You should use the application which icon is an orange square with a white X in it.

If you use the latest XAMPP controls application, then tell me where you've installed XAMPP. Is it in '/Applications/XAMPP/'?
